We will build a security system which will detect if any person is within a restricted area within a room. The overall system will consist of one base station and two or more camera systems. Each camera system will interface with a camera that is monitoring a room from different angles, use a computer vision library/algorithm to detect and generate bounding boxes for people in the room, and send all this information to the base system. The base system will aggregate all this data, make a decision on whether there are any people in the forbidden area, and additionally display all video feeds and bounding boxes via HDMI.
